On June 10, 2007 at 12:50, Falcon1 said...
Is there any need for soldering to be done when replacing
the screen?
I'm not new to soldering but I have not much experience
with soldering very littler things.

I guess I'm looking for such a replace touchscreen if
the guy I bought it from will not answer.



Yes soldering is needed. And yes it's very delicated. It's also hard to take the old touchscreen out. And finally the ipaq 1940 series touchscreen is smaller, you have to position it right and you will end with bars on top and botton of the screen, but it will work nice. A lot more sensible then the OEM touchscreen.
